Moto X play

Does Moto X play worth ₹18,499??

Motorola finally launched the new member of their Moto X family the Moto X play starting at the price of ₹18,499 for the 16 GB variant and ₹19,999 for the 32 GB variant.


Moto X play is powered by a Qualcomm snapdragon 615 octa core CPU coupled with 2GB RAM and a Adreno 405 GPU. The Moto X play sports a 5.5 inch 1920X1080p full HD display with the pixel density of 403ppi and corning gorilla glass 3 protection. Moving to the camera Moto X comes with a massive 21MP rear autofocus and auto-HDR with dual LED flash and 5MP front camera. Moto X is also a water repellent device like Moto G 3 and it also comes with MicroSD card support up to 128GB. Moto X play gets it juice from a 3630 mAh  battery and it runs on the latest Android 5.1.1 lollipop.
